Step Up and Strike (Combat)

When a foe tries to move away, you can follow and make an attack.

Prerequisites: Dex 13, Following Step, Step Up, base attack bonus +6.

Benefit: When using the Step Up or Following Step feats to follow an adjacent foe, you may also make a single melee attack against that foe at your highest base attack bonus. This attack counts as one of your attacks of opportunity for the round. Using this feat does not count toward the number of actions you can usually take each round.

Normal: You can usually only take one standard action and one 5-foot step each round.
